Job Summary:JOB DESCRIPTION – SENIOR ACCOUNTANTLocation: Prague, Czech RepublicDivision: Ticketmaster Česká republika, a.s.Line Manager: Finance DirectorContract Terms: Permanent, 40 hours per weekTHE JOBReporting to the Director of Finance, the Senior Accountant will be responsible for the overall day to day running of the finance function. Ensuring timely and accurate execution of all accounting processes including; AP, AR, Banking, Management Accounts, Taxation, Financial reporting, Internal/external Auditing and Statutory reporting obligations.  The ideal candidate is reliable, efficient and thrives in a challenging, fast-paced environment. Knowledge or passion of the music/entertainment industry always a plus.  As a leader of the Finance Team, you will be partnering with all areas of the business and interacting with many different stakeholders. You will gain an in-depth understanding of the day to day running of the department and oversee the daily accounting and financial reporting activities of the business.WHAT YOU WILL BE DOINGLead the finance teamPosting month-end accounting journals including wagesReview and preparation of accruals, internal documentsReview of general ledgerPreparation of monthly reconciliation of balance sheet accountsReconciliation of intercompany transactions and balancesPreparation of VAT returns, cooperation with tax advisorWeekly/monthly reporting tasksDoing other ad hoc tasks based on the instructions from Finance Director or MDResponsibility for preparing documents for audits and cooperating with auditorsResponsibility for preparing and submitting statistical returnsStaying updated with relevant accounting standards, and regulationsWHAT YOU NEED TO KNOW (or TECHNICAL SKILLS)University degree in AccountingSenior-level accounting experience requiredVery good knowledge of the Czech accounting procedures, policies, regulations, and rulesFundamental knowledge of US GAAPPossess PC proficiency, especially in ExcelExperience with Oracle preferredFluent in Czech and EnglishYOU (BEHAVIOURAL SKILLS)Be able to work independentlyAttention to detail and ability to work under pressureGood time management skills and ability to meet deadlineBe able to identify any issues related to the work or the team in time LIFE AT TICKETMASTERWe are proud to be a part of Live Nation Entertainment, the world’s largest live entertainment company.Our vision at Ticketmaster is to connect people around the world to the live events they love.
